Dan Inosanto: a Prominent Filipino-American Self-defense Instructor
Dan Inosanto is among the well-known martial artists in the world. He is the foremost authority
on JKD, a martial art that Bruce Lee developed. He is a Filipino self-defense instructor who is also known for
promoting the martial arts indigenous to the Filipinos to the world.
A self-defense instructor with Filipino heritage but based in California, USA,
Dan Inosanto was born on the 24th of July in 1936. He was raised in Stockton, California and a degree in B.A. at
Whitworth College, Spokane, Washington.
Before Dan Inosanto became a student of Bruce Lee and learned the Jeet Kune Do, he studied the
Okinawan, Japanese and Korean Karate and was studying Kenpo karate under Ed Parker. He also became a martial
art and self-defense instructor of Kenpo karate for Ed Parker.
Dan Inosanto met Bruce Lee in 1964. He became a close companion of Bruce Lee until the latter’s
death in 1973. After the death of the most popular martial artist in the world, he has become the unofficial
spokesperson of Jeet Kune Do and has the authority to teach the martial arts along with other two individuals
designated by Bruce Lee.
Dan Inosanto has become well-known for teaching various martial arts. Aside from being the
instructor of Jeet Kune Do, he also teaches Filipino Martial Arts, Brazilian Jiu Jitsu, Penjak Silat, Muay Thai,
Malaysian Bersilat, French savate, Japanes Shoot Wrestling and Krabi-Krabong.
Dan Inosanto is also notable for the promotion of Filipino Martial Arts as well as the
introduction of Filipino martial artists such as Leo Gaje and Edgar Sulite to the world. He also introduced
Indonesian martial artist Pendekar Paul de Thouars and Burmese martial artist Maung Gyi to the world martial arts
community.
Aside from being responsible for the introduction of world-class Asian martial artists, Dan
Inosanto has also made contributions to the careers of some martial artists known today. His students notably
include Brandon Lee, Erik Paulson, Paul Vunak, Greg Nelson, Ron Balicki, Ernest Emerson, larry Hartsell and Burton
Richardson.
A self-defense instructor, Dan Inosanto is also responsible for the establishment of Inosanto
Acandemy of Martial Arts. The academy is known for producing among the notorious martial organizations in the
United States, the Dog Brothers.
Dan Inosanto appeared in several American movies including the movie Game of Death, the last
film of Bruce Lee. He was also featured and made appearances in some documentaries mostly about Bruce Lee. He also
published books about martial arts particularly the Jeet Kune Do.
Dan Inosanto still currently holds seminars and martial arts training. He is currently regarded
among the prominent ambassadors of martial arts in the world.
